‘Bad Boys For Life’ Star Jacob Scipio Joins Leslie Grace In DC’s ‘Batgirl’

Following a breakout performance in Lin-Manuel Miranda’s In The Heights, Leslie Grace will become DC’s next big superhero in Batgirl. Now, another recent breakout star is joining the cast of the highly anticipated film as well. As first reported by Deadline, Bad Boys For Life star as first Jacob Scipio is joining the DC family in Batgirl as well.
No word yet on who Scipio will play in the film. However, the casting reunites Scipio with his Bad Boys for Life directors Adil El Arbi and Bilall Fallah, who will helm the feature. Additionally, Birds of Prey scribe Christina Hodson wrote the script with HBO Max handling the movie’s distribution via the streaming service. J.K. Simmons is also onboard to reprise his role as Commissioner Gordon after previously portraying the character in Justice League.
During this weekend’s DC FanDome event, fans got their first look at the concept art for the live-action version of the character. Additionally, during a recent interview, Leslie Grace revealed her approach to her adaptation of Batgirl AKA Barbara Gordon.

“She’s someone who’s been underestimated by even her own dad and being the youngest kid, sometimes you’re insulated from all of the tough stuff of life and she’s so eager to prove to herself and to everybody else that there’s some things that she can handle,” Grace says. “So, this journey is definitely going to show me a lot of that. I feel like I’m on an endless journey of proving to myself what barriers I can break, what limits I can break for myself and I’m excited to put a little bit of that eagerness and drive and, like, almost a bit of stubbornness into Barbara’s character.”
Jacob Scipio’s breakthrough performance came as the main villain, and Will Smith‘s son, in 2020’s Bad Boys For Life. However, prior to that, the actor touts a slew of lead TV roles in shows like Disney’s As the Bell Rings and BBC’s Some Girls. Most recently, Scipio appeared opposite Michael B. Jordan and Jodie Turner-Smith in Amazon’s Without Remorse. According to IMDb, Scipio will next star alongside Nicholas Cage and Pedro Pascal in The Unbearable Weight of Massive Talent.
